- Siemens Smart Infrastructure - Electrification and Automation Business is one of the leading global suppliers of products, integrated systems, solutions, and services for the sustainable, reliable, and efficient transmission, distribution and control of energy. Siemens Smart Infrastructure has an exciting opportunity for a Project Procurement Management Professional to join our team based in our Sydney offices.
As a Project Procurement Management Professional your primary responsibility will be to provide procurement support for our project teams from the initial tender and bid phase to project execution. In this role you will handle, control, and monitor all procurement and if required, manage the purchasing activities in each project. You will also support Factory Procurement in sourcing activities, supplier management and supplier optimization, Negotiate Framework Agreements with key factory suppliers to reduce risk and optimize costs, and deliver on Factory procurement KPI's related to Purchase Price Change. This is a key role within the Siemens Smart Infrastructure business, and demands an individual who has a positive, energetic, motivational, and collaborative attitude. You will lead a culture of ownership, with our people and the customer at the core.
Your key responsibilities will include:
- Participate in project/sales meetings as project core team member to exert a shaping influence at an early stage and to optimize internal workflows and processes.
- Meet with cross-functional partners and participate in project/sales meetings to provide procurement market and preferred supplier information at an early stage to optimize supplier selection, internal workflows and processes.
- Establishes proper sourcing and Procurement processes and controls all Procurement resources and activities in the project.
- Analyze customer inquiries during bid preparation / opportunity management phases and exactly understands the customer's functional needs in order to include (supplier) innovations.
- Support project calculation with reliable material cost data.
- Analyze scope of supply and contract agreements, carries out risk analyses and introduces negotiation recommendations.
- Analyze sales and operations planning in respect of starting / new projects, assessing, and controlling of material costs within the whole project business in order to ensure the involvement of Procurement.
- Drive Procurement strategies across key commodities and ensures their implementation.
- Head up contractual and price negotiations and/or supports the specialist buyers responsible for particular material fields.
- Ensure that mitigation of Procurement risks, changes to original scope of supply and potential claims (towards customers and suppliers) are covered in valid contracts.
- Ensure that contractual obligations towards the customer that must be fulfilled by supplier are covered in a way that mitigates the own risk exposure.
- Clarify internal indicators for project controlling and compiling all relevant information to submit qualified reports.
- Lead Supplier Performance Management initiatives - conduct supplier qualifications & project-specific supplier evaluations (project evaluations) and supplier development activities. Follow-up with suppliers in regard to NCC costs
- Support Factory Procurement in sourcing activities, supplier management and supplier optimization
- Negotiate Framework Agreements with key factory suppliers to reduce risk and optimize costs
- Forward systematically all relevant Procurement related project information.
- Deliver on Factory procurement KPI's related to Purchase Price Change.
